"Apple's 2025 Design Awards: Balatro, Dredge, PBJ The Musical Win Big"

With the 2025 Apple Design Awards now in the books, all eyes are on this year’s standout winners — a mix of bold innovation, immersive gameplay, and stunning visual design that continues to push the boundaries of what iOS gaming can achieve. Recognizing excellence across a diverse set of categories such as innovation, interaction, inclusivity, and the ever-charming ‘delight & fun’, these awards shine a spotlight on mobile games that go above and beyond.

If you missed the announcements amidst the whirlwind of 2025's gaming news, here’s a quick rundown of the major winners:

Balatro – Winner in “Delight & Fun”

LocalThunk’s critically acclaimed deckbuilding roguelike, Balatro, has taken yet another trophy home. Its transition from PC to mobile was not only seamless but also wildly successful, bringing fast-paced poker-based chaos into the palms of players everywhere. It’s no wonder Apple recognized it for delivering pure joy and addictive gameplay.

PBJ: The Musical – Winner in “Innovation”

This quirky musical puzzler reimagines Shakespeare’s *Romeo and Juliet* with peanut butter and jelly as the leads. A wild concept paired with clever mechanics earned it the Innovation award, proving that sometimes the strangest ideas make for the most memorable experiences.

Dredge – Winner in “Interaction”

Making waves with its eerie blend of fishing and cosmic horror, Dredge delivers a unique experience that translates beautifully to mobile. Its win in the Interaction category is well-deserved recognition for how effectively it immerses players in its atmospheric world.

Art of Fauna – Winner in “Inclusivity”

This charming wildlife-themed puzzle game puts conservation and accessibility at the forefront. Its gentle learning curve and inclusive design made it a perfect fit for this important category, showing that thoughtful development can be both engaging and socially responsible.

Neva – Winner in “Social Impact”

In this emotionally rich action-adventure title, players follow a young girl and her wolf companion through a hauntingly beautiful world shaped by environmental loss. Neva’s inclusion in this category highlights the growing importance of narrative depth and thematic relevance in modern mobile games.

Infinity Nikki – Winner in “Visuals & Graphics”

Love it or not, Infinity Nikki is undeniably a visual masterpiece. With its dazzling fashion-based gameplay and eye-catching aesthetics, it’s no surprise Apple gave it top honors in one of the most visually competitive categories.

Apple Makes Its Mark

The Apple Design Awards continue to be a powerful platform for recognizing the creativity and technical prowess found in iOS titles. This year’s lineup reaffirms that mobile isn’t just a secondary platform—it’s where groundbreaking ideas come to life. Balatro and Dredge, in particular, have shown that even niche genres can find success and acclaim on mobile.
